Root Canal Treatment: A Guide for Patients

Root canal treatment is a dental procedure that is often necessary when the tooth nerve is inflamed or dead. It is a process that saves the tooth from the inside out and relieves pain. This guide will tell you everything you need to know about root canal treatment.

Why is root canal treatment necessary?

When the inner part of the tooth, known as the dental nerve, through Caries or is damaged in an accident, it may ignite or die. This can cause pain and swelling. A root canal treatment removes the damaged or dead nerve, cleans the canal, and seals it to prevent further infection.

The sequence

Cleaning

The diseased tooth nerve is removed using special files and the root canal is cleaned.

Disinfection

The cleaned canal is disinfected with special rinsing solutions to remove all bacteria and residues.

After treatment

It's normal to feel some pain or discomfort for a few days after a root canal treatment. This can be relieved with over-the-counter painkillers. It is important to handle the treated tooth carefully and avoid hard or sticky foods for the first few days after treatment.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is root canal treatment painful?

No, the treatment is performed under local anesthesia, so you will not feel any pain during the procedure.

How long does a root canal treatment take?

The duration depends on the complexity of the case, but usually takes 1-2 hours.

What are the risks of root canal treatment?

As with any medical procedure, there are risks, but they are minimal. Your dentist will discuss all potential risks and benefits with you.

How long does a tooth last after root canal treatment?

With proper care, a tooth can last a lifetime after root canal treatment.

Can I eat normally after treatment?

It is recommended to rest the treated tooth for a few days and avoid hard or sticky foods.

How much does a root canal treatment cost?

Costs vary depending on the complexity of the case and the location of the practice. It is best to discuss this directly with your dentist.
